You're really going to want a ranged weapon. Not just for dragons, but for bandits up on cliffs or guards on walls, and for more heavily armored foes. Since speed is now the same for all people, it will really hurt your "agile blademaster" ideal. Overall you will have a pretty hard time, but it's not impossible if you can dodge arrows and side-specialize in stealth and alchemy.
